Stroma's TV appearance

Stroma is pleased to have featured in NHS247 Solutions for a Sustainable Health Environment documentary.

Presented by Georgina Burnett and featuring Sir Ian McAllister CBE, Chairman of the Carbon Trust, the documentary looks at how the healthcare sector can meet government energy efficiency and carbon reduction targets. As Europe's largest employer and the greatest public sector contributor of UK CO² emissions (producing an estimated 3% of the national output) the NHS must place sustainability at the top of its healthcare agenda. Solutions for a Sustainable Health Environment tackles why and how this can be achieved.

Rob Coxon, Director of Stroma, appeared on the show as guest speaker, to discuss Stroma's energy and carbon reduction approaches for the health sector. Rob comments:

"As specialists in all aspects of building performance analysis and improvement, Stroma can help NHS Managers to cut energy costs and reduce carbon emissions, without compromising daily operations. We can help meet reduction targets through measures that are essentially self-financing.2
